15 was sarcasm.

The problem with a lot of the Knicks picks is they're either protected or late first round.

2024: Not set in stone, but currently 23 & 25 - will stay close to that.
2025 - Knicks pick, probably in the 20s again, unless they go south. BUcks pick (2025) - again, probably 20s.
2026 - Knicks pick . . . 2 years out and good chance in the 20s again.

Pistons Pick - might be the most valuable of the set, but could end up turning into a 2nd.
Wizards Pick - again, potenitally pretty good, but Wiz seem committed to tanking, so might turn into a 2nd.

None of those picks have high values, so I think it takes Bogs, filler and 3 picks to get Mikal but I'd be happy if it takes less.

Of course, if a player another team covets falls to 23, then the value of that pick goes up, but that would depend on circumstances.
